Why Is It Needed for France?
French authorities may request police certificates to assess background history for work permits, study, residency or family immigration.
To better understand the process, it helps to know what a police clearance certificate is in South Africa.
Common Uses
- Work permits
- Talent visas
- Student visas
- Family reunification
- Residency pathways
- Long-term stays

Can You Apply From France?
Yes. Many South Africans living in Paris, Lyon, Marseille, Toulouse and across France apply remotely.
This is common for South Africans applying for police clearance certificates from abroad.
What You May Need
- Fingerprints
- Passport copy
- South African ID copy
- Application details
- Courier arrangements
Clear fingerprints are important because they affect how long a police clearance certificate takes.
Important Tip
Always verify current French immigration document requirements before submitting.
In many cases, documents may also need to be apostilled for international use.
